SUBJECT: Permit No. NC0023337
Authorization to Construct
Town of Scotland Neck
Wastewater Treatment Plant Additions
EPA Project No. C370484-02
The final plans and specifications for the subject project have been
reviewed and found to be satisfactory. Authorization is hereby granted for
upgrading the existing 0.6 MGD activated sludge treatment facilities to
advanced wastewater treatment facilities by the installation of an influent
flow division chamber, parallel dual channel basins for aeration and
digestion, an additional final clarifier with return sludge system, sludge
transfer pump station with dual 250 GPM pumps, conventional sludge drying
beds, chlorination, dual final tertiary filters with post aeration, and
influent and effluent sampling facilities.
You are cautioned not to advertise or initiate construction until
so notified by EPA, if Federal Funding is desired for project construction.
Instructions regarding bidding procedures and the authority to advertise
for construction bid will be sent to you, with the Grant offer from EPA.
The Permittee shall employ an actively State certified wastewater
treatment plant operator to be in responsible charge of the wastewater
treatment facilities. Such operator must hold a State certificate of the
grade at least equivalent to the classification assigned to the wastewater
treatment facilities by the Certification Commission. When a new chief
operator must be obtained to be in responsible charge of the new facilities,
it is required that this be done by the time the construction of the facili-
ties is 50% completed.
This Authorization to Construct is issued in accordance with Part 3
Paragraph C of NPDES Permit No. NC0023337 issued November 30, 1981,
and shall be subject to revocation unless the wastewater treatment facilities
are constructed in accordance with the approved plans, specifications, support-
ing documents, and are in compliance with the conditions and limitations
specified in Permit No. NC0023337.

In the issuance of this Authorization to Construct, your attention is
directed to the following:
1. During the construction of the proposed additions/modifications,
the Permitee shall continue to properly maintain and operate
the existing wastewater treatment facilities at all times, and
in such manner, as necessary to comply with the effluent limits
specified in the NPDES Permit.
2. The Perrnittee must obtain a sludge analysis and a sludge E.P.
Toxicity analysis; and subsequent approval of these analyse:-
from the Division of health Services, Solid Waste Manage:.,ent
Branch prior to the disposal of any sludge from the new waste—
water treatment plant. Copies of the analyses, supporting
documents, and approvals shall be submitted to the Division of
Environmental Management, Water Quality Section and the Washington
Regional Office. In addition, selling or free distributing of
wet, dried, composted sludge or sludge —like material without a
permit for each disposal site from this Division, is illegal.
